What is "penetration testing"?

Penetration testing refers to the process of simulating attacks on a computer system, network, or web application to identify vulnerabilities that could potentially be exploited by malicious actors. This approach helps organizations to understand their security weaknesses by putting their defenses to the test in a controlled environment. The goal of penetration testing is not just to find weaknesses but also to evaluate the effectiveness of security measures in place and to ensure that vulnerabilities are addressed before they can be exploited in real-life attacks.

By conducting penetration tests, organizations can proactively discover and remediate security flaws, thereby improving their overall cybersecurity posture. This practice is essential in today’s digital landscape, where new vulnerabilities are constantly emerging, and cyber threats are becoming increasingly sophisticated.
